Transaction 807ec282a36a63321091db654a2efc19d3f4b8f0d3a81f7065ea47232e83cf03
1 Input
1 Output
-
807ec282a36a63321091db654a2efc19d3f4b8f0d3a81f7065ea47232e83cf03:0
- value
- 1499887
- script pubkey
- OP_0 OP_PUSHBYTES_32 67c30dce10a3538be3e4bb27c075fc75ad567100b2245a9382a81fbaea31b7d0
- address
- bc1qvlpsmnss5dfchclyhvnuqa0uwkk4vugqkgj94yuz4q0m4633klgqyq0qyf